The definitive book in its field since 1974, Export-Import Financing provides global traders, U.S. and foreign bankers, and students of global commerce with a complete, current, and in-depth guide to every aspect of global trade financing
This newly revised and updated Fourth Edition includes the latest techniques and vehicles for financing all types of export and import operations. Here is the latest information on emerging markets, new hedging techniques, particular areas of risk for import and export, recent regulations governing documentary credit, and new financing rules. Export-Import Financing covers a wide range of topics, from foreign trade definitions, bank guarantees, and risk management, to shipping and collection, and the latest legislation
Export-Import Financing, Fourth Edition, contains invaluable information on banking deregulation, international bank custody operations, bank involvement in insurance, changes in the maritime industry, and much more. Harry M. Venedikian is currently International Trade Officer at Chase Manhattan Bank. Previously, he was at Banque du Caire. He is a professor at New York University, Pace University, and the American Institute of Banking, where he teaches classes in international banking, trading, and management. Mr. Venedikian received his MBA and BPS at Pace University and his DSPC at Ecole Superieure de Commerce in Paris. Gerald A. Warfield is the author of two previous financial books, The Investor's Guide to Stock Quotations and How to Buy Foreign Stocks and Bonds. He is listed in Who's Who in America and Who's Who in the World. He received his BA from North Texas State University and his MFA from Princeton University.
